**What is EPS 100 Polystyrene?**
EPS 100 polystyrene is a lightweight, rigid plastic foam material that is made from solid beads of polystyrene It is produced through a process of heating the beads with steam, which causes them to expand and fuse together The result is a closed-cell foam material that is known for its excellent thermal insulation properties.
**Benefits of EPS 100 Polystyrene**
One of the main benefits of EPS 100 polystyrene is its high insulation value The closed-cell structure of the foam material creates a barrier that prevents the transfer of heat, making it an excellent choice for insulating buildings and other structures This can help to reduce energy costs and improve the overall energy efficiency of a building.
EPS 100 polystyrene is also lightweight and easy to handle, making it a favored material for construction projects Its rigidity and durability make it an ideal choice for applications where strength and stability are essential, such as in foundations, walls, and roofs Additionally, EPS 100 polystyrene is resistant to moisture and mold, making it a long-lasting and low-maintenance insulation option.
Another benefit of EPS 100 polystyrene is its versatility It can be easily cut and shaped to fit specific dimensions, making it adaptable to a wide range of applications Whether it is used as insulation in buildings, packaging material for fragile items, or as a protective layer for products during shipping, EPS 100 polystyrene offers flexibility and customization options for various needs.
**Uses of EPS 100 Polystyrene**
EPS 100 polystyrene is commonly used in the construction industry for thermal insulation purposes eps 100 polystyrene. It is often used in walls, floors, and roofs of buildings to improve energy efficiency and create a more comfortable indoor environment The lightweight nature of EPS 100 polystyrene also makes it easier to transport and install on construction sites.
In addition to construction, EPS 100 polystyrene is also used in packaging materials Its cushioning properties make it an ideal choice for protecting fragile items during shipping and storage The shock-absorbing capabilities of EPS 100 polystyrene can help prevent damage to delicate products and ensure they arrive at their destination intact.
EPS 100 polystyrene is also used in various other industries, such as the automotive sector for soundproofing and insulation in vehicles Its ability to reduce noise and vibrations makes it a valuable material for improving the comfort and performance of cars, trucks, and other transportation vehicles.
Furthermore, EPS 100 polystyrene is a sustainable choice for many applications It is 100% recyclable and can be reused in new products, reducing the environmental impact of waste and promoting a circular economy By choosing EPS 100 polystyrene, businesses can contribute to a more eco-friendly and sustainable future.
